Reid's online site up, in race
Candidate pays for roryreid.com
By FRANK GEARY
LAS VEGAS REVIEW-JOURNAL

Sep. 20, 2009

Gene Smith, who in 2002 registered Internet domain names featuring the
names of Southern Nevada politicians, sold roryreid.com for $10,000 to
Reid, who is using the site in his campaign for governor..
